INDIAN PRINCESS.

ON EDUCATIONAL TOUR. i BRIEF CALL AT AUCKLAND. (Per Press Association.) AUCKLAND, January 21. \ Having toured Europe and America and attended the Coronation ceremonies in England, Princess Chennajammanni of Mysore, India, arrived at Auckland by ' the Monterey accompanied by her husband, Delavoy Madan Rajurs. The princess is a member of the family ruling at Mysore, and the present Maharajah is a cousin. Both she and her husband are University educated and are undertaking a world tour for educational purposes. After attending the Coronation and then touring Europe, the princess and her husband travelled to New York on the liner Queen Mary. They spent today sight-seeing around Auckland, nad continued their voyage on the Monterey to Sydney. They will return to India via Java, Singapore and Colombo. They did not originally intend coming via New Zealand, but they were desirous of visiting some of the British Dominions. The princess and her husband were accompanied by Mr F. Wagner, of the London office of Thos. Cook and Sons,
